Through an agreement signed today, the much-loved animals will continue to delight visitors for … Web18 mrt. 2024 · The China Conservation and Research Center for the Giant Panda on Tuesday welcomed the birth of the world's first pair of captive-bred giant panda twins this year. The mother panda Fuwa gave birth to the male twins, weighing 159.8 grams and 119.5 grams, respectively, on Tuesday. Both are healthy and breast-fed by their mother. …

The UK’s first ever panda arrived at London Zoo in 1938, with four of them, including Ming the panda, arriving around this period. Ming one of the UK's first ever pandas plays football at London Zoo as a baby in 1939.
